About Howdon Pans
Howdon Pans is a small area located in Tyne and Wear, England, within the NE28 postcode area. This locality is situated near the River Tyne and offers a mix of residential and industrial landscapes. The proximity to the river provides opportunities for riverside walks and views of the waterway, which has historically been significant for the region's development.
The area is primarily residential, with various housing options available. Local amenities can be found nearby, including shops and schools, catering to the needs of residents. Howdon Pans is also well-connected by public transport, making it accessible for those travelling to nearby towns and cities. The surrounding areas offer additional facilities and recreational opportunities, contributing to the community's overall functionality.

House Prices in Howdon Pans
Property prices average £163K across the area, and terraced houses are the most common property type, typically selling for £131K.

Household Income in Howdon Pans ONS 2023
The average total household income in Howdon Pans is approximately £41,119 a year before tax, 26% below the national average of £55,302. After tax and benefits, the average disposable (net) household income is around £32,112. These are modelled estimates from the Office for National Statistics for the financial year ending 2023.

Businesses in Howdon Pans ONS 2025
There are approximately 853 active businesses based in Howdon Pans, around 19 for every 1,000 residents. The local economy is dominated by small firms: about 88% are micro-businesses employing fewer than 10 people, while 19 are larger employers with 50 or more staff. Figures are from the Office for National Statistics UK Business Counts.

Home Ownership in Howdon Pans
Of the 21,542 households in and around Howdon Pans, 56% are owned, 26% are socially rented and 18% are privately rented. Home ownership here is lower than the England and Wales average of 63%.
Tenure from the 2021 Census (ONS), for the postcode districts covering Howdon Pans.
